Cristian Romero to Atlético Madrid: Agreement Reached with Tottenham

Cristian Romero is set to join Atlético Madrid after the clubs reached an agreement, according to reports. The deal is valued at €40 million including add-ons.
Earlier negotiations with Inter fell through in July, and Barcelona decided not to proceed days ago. Tottenham were reportedly never willing to sell Romero to Arsenal.
Atletico Madrid have now completed the transfer.
